Sutherland, Neil – Hist Educ Quart, 1969
The history of urban education can be more clearly seen by focusing upon the child as a learner rather than as the object of teaching. This implies awareness of the relative educative effects of education and environment and gives an improved perspective on educating the urban child. (DE)

Milton, Barbara; And Others – Journal of Environmental Education, 1995
Describes a pilot project of the Park/School Program which involved graduate students in environmental studies conducting field studies in ecology with 46 fifth graders. Provides an overview of the project's potential for effecting change inside and outside the classroom, and presents recommendations for future programs and research. (LZ)
